TAYLOR, Mich. (WXYZ) — An 18-month old is recovering from non-fatal injuries after a freeway shooting on northbound I-75.

On June 21 around 3:30 p.m., Lincoln Park police responded to a non-fatal shooting on the northbound I-75 ramp the Outer Drive. Officer requested MSP take over the investigation.

A preliminary investigation revealed that a suspect pulled along side the victim's car and shot at it numerous times, according to MSP.

Troopers say an 18-month old child was struck by the gunfire. The child was taken to a local hospital with non-fatal injuries.

MSP says this is not a random incident. The investigation is ongoing.
